COVID-19 vaccines can cause mild side effects after the first or second dose, including: Pain, redness or swelling where the shot was given Fever Fatigue Headache Muscle pain Chills Joint pain Nausea and vomiting Swollen lymph nodes Feeling unwell Most side effects go away in a few days. Lymphadenopathy occurred in the arm and neck region and was reported within 2 to 4 days after vaccination. An uncommon side effect is swollen glands in the armpit or neck, on the same side as the arm where you had the vaccine.
